Americaβs Blood Centers (ABC) is seeking a Communications and Marketing Manager to support and strengthen our mission-driven work. In this role, youβll work closely with colleagues to create clear, useful, and engaging communications that serve our member organizationsβfrom member updates and digital content to marketing materials and press statements. This is a great opportunity for a communications professional who enjoys collaboration, is eager to build skills, and wants to help ensure members have the tools, information, and visibility they need to fulfill their lifesaving mission. Key responsibilities include Member Communications: develop, draft, and distribute member communications including email updates, announcements, and special alerts; ensure messaging is accurate, timely, and aligned with the associationβs mission and strategic priorities; collaborate with internal stakeholders to translate complex healthcare topics into clear, and member-friendly communications; Website Management: manage and maintain the associationβs website, including content updates, organization, design, and SEO optimization; partner with vendors on website enhancements and functionality improvements; ensure content is current, accessible, and consistent in tone and brand; Media & Public Relations: serve as the primary point of contact for press inquiries coordinating responses as needed; draft press releases, statements, and talking points; monitor media coverage relevant to the association and ensure stakeholders are aware of key topics of interest; Design & Creative Work: create and update visual assets such as graphics, flyers, social media images, email templates, and simple promotional materials; ensure all communications adhere to brand guidelines and maintain a professional, cohesive look; collaborate with vendors on larger design or branding projects as needed. Required: Bachelorβs degree in Communications, Journalism, Public Relations, Marketing, or a related field; 3+ years of relevant professional communications experience; excellent writing, editing, and proofreading skills; experience managing websites and content management systems (CMS); experience managing organizational social media accounts; strong organizational skills and ability to manage multiple priorities independently. What We Offer: fully remote work environment; competitive salary commensurate with experience; comprehensive benefits package including health, dental, and vision insurance; flexible paid time off and paid holidays; meaningful work supporting the blood community.
